What Criteria Determine the Best Mattress Award?

The criteria that determine the best mattress award include various key factors influencing comfort, support, and durability.

  1. Comfort Level
  2. Support and Alignment
  3. Durability and Longevity
  4. Pressure Relief
  5. Temperature Regulation
  6. Materials and Quality
  7. Edge Support
  8. Motion Isolation
  9. Warranty and Trial Period

The weight of each criterion can vary depending on individual needs and preferences, making it important to explore each factor in detail.

  1. Comfort Level: The comfort level of a mattress primarily refers to the sensation and feel when lying on it. This includes factors like the softness or firmness of the surface. A mattress that prioritizes comfort often employs materials that adjust to body shape, such as memory foam or latex. According to the Sleep Foundation, preferences for firmness can range significantly among individuals; therefore, finding the right match is crucial for a good night’s sleep.

  2. Support and Alignment: Support and alignment denote how well a mattress maintains the spine’s natural curvature. A supportive mattress prevents back pain by ensuring that the sleeper’s spine remains aligned while asleep. A 2021 study published by the National Institutes of Health found that mattresses providing adequate lumbar support enhance comfort levels and reduce discomfort while sleeping.

  3. Durability and Longevity: Durability and longevity refer to how well a mattress holds up over time without sagging or losing its supportive features. High-quality materials, like high-density foam or latex, tend to have a longer lifespan. According to a Consumer Reports analysis, a good mattress should last between 7 to 10 years, and choosing the right materials can directly affect this longevity.

  4. Pressure Relief: Pressure relief is vital for minimizing discomfort during sleep. A mattress with good pressure relief adapts to the sleeper’s body, relieving tension from sensitive areas like shoulders and hips. Research by the University of Kentucky in 2019 highlighted that memory foam mattresses tend to outperform traditional mattresses in providing pressure relief.

  5. Temperature Regulation: Temperature regulation involves how well a mattress can maintain a comfortable sleeping temperature. Some mattresses contain cooling technologies or breathable materials to prevent overheating during sleep. A study conducted by the Sleep Research Society in 2022 revealed that consumers reported better sleep quality on mattresses designed with temperature-regulating properties.

  6. Materials and Quality: The materials used in crafting a mattress play a significant role in defining quality and comfort. Mattresses can be made from foam, innerspring, latex, or hybrid combinations. The Better Sleep Council emphasizes that high-quality materials can improve sleep quality and reduce allergens.

  7. Edge Support: Edge support refers to the mattress’s ability to maintain its structure and support when sitting or lying near the edge. Better edge support allows for easier access to the bed and maximizes sleeping space. A 2020 study in the Journal of Sleep Research found that mattresses with reinforced edges enhance usability and overall satisfaction.

  8. Motion Isolation: Motion isolation indicates how well a mattress absorbs movement. This is crucial for couples, as it minimizes disturbances caused by a partner’s movements. A 2023 study from the Journal of Sleep Medicine noted that memory foam beds generally excel in this category due to their material properties.

  9. Warranty and Trial Period: The warranty and trial period reflect the manufacturer’s confidence in their product. A longer warranty usually indicates durability, while a trial period allows consumers to test the mattress in their home environment. Consumer Reports suggests that a trial period of at least 100 nights is beneficial for ensuring satisfactory sleep before making a final commitment.

Why is Comfort Crucial in Selecting a Mattress?

Comfort is crucial in selecting a mattress because it directly affects sleep quality and overall well-being. A comfortable mattress can contribute to better rest, while an uncomfortable one can lead to poor sleep and related health issues.

According to the National Sleep Foundation, comfort is defined as the quality of being physically relaxed and free from pain. A comfortable sleeping surface allows the body to rest and rejuvenate effectively.

The underlying reasons why comfort matters in mattress selection include support, pressure relief, and alignment. A supportive mattress helps maintain the natural curvature of the spine. Pressure relief is vital for preventing discomfort that can arise from prolonged pressure on specific body parts. Proper spinal alignment ensures that the body is in a neutral position during sleep.

Technical terms like “support” refer to how well the mattress maintains the body’s weight without sagging. “Pressure relief” describes the mattress’s ability to distribute body weight evenly. A mattress that is too firm may not provide adequate pressure relief, while a mattress that is too soft may lack support.

Detailed explanations include the mechanisms of sleep. During sleep, the body undergoes various cycles, including deep sleep and REM (Rapid Eye Movement) sleep. Poor comfort can disrupt these cycles, leading to fragmented sleep. Factors like body weight, sleeping position, and personal preferences also influence comfort. For example, side sleepers may require a softer mattress to cushion the shoulders and hips, while back sleepers may benefit from a firmer option for better support.

Specific conditions contributing to discomfort include existing health issues such as arthritis or back pain. Individuals with such conditions may require a mattress designed to alleviate pressure and provide proper support. For instance, a memory foam mattress can contour to the body’s shape and relieve pressure points, making it a favorable choice for these individuals.

How Does Durability Affect Long-term Mattress Performance?

Durability significantly affects long-term mattress performance. Durable mattresses maintain their structural integrity and comfort over time. They resist sagging, indentations, and material breakdown. Higher durability ensures that a mattress provides proper support, which is essential for spinal alignment and overall sleep quality.

The key components that contribute to durability include materials, construction, and design. Quality materials, like high-density foam or sturdy coils, enhance a mattress’s lifespan. Constructive techniques, such as reinforced edges, also improve stability and prevent premature wear.

When a mattress is durable, it retains its intended feel and functionality longer. This means fewer replacements, leading to better value over time. A mattress with poor durability may develop issues like lumps or soft spots, compromising comfort and support.

In summary, durability directly influences how well a mattress performs throughout its life. It impacts comfort, support, and the overall experience of sleep, making it a crucial factor in mattress selection.

Which Mattresses Are the Top Picks for 2025?

The top picks for mattresses in 2025 include various models focusing on comfort, support, and durability, while catering to different sleep preferences.

  1. Memory Foam Mattresses
  2. Innerspring Mattresses
  3. Hybrid Mattresses
  4. Latex Mattresses
  5. Adjustable Air Mattresses
  6. Eco-Friendly Mattresses

To understand these top picks better, let’s delve into each type of mattress and their unique qualities.

  1. Memory Foam Mattresses: Memory foam mattresses use viscoelastic foam to conform to the sleeper’s body. They offer pressure relief and excellent body contouring. According to a 2022 study by The Sleep Foundation, memory foam mattresses reduce tossing and turning, benefiting side sleepers. Popular brands like Tempur-Pedic lead this category due to their innovative foam technologies.

  2. Innerspring Mattresses: Innerspring mattresses consist of a core support system using steel coils. These mattresses are known for their bounciness and support. A survey by Consumer Reports in 2021 found that innerspring mattresses are favored by stomach sleepers for their firmness. Brands like Saatva emphasize durability and classic design in this category.

  3. Hybrid Mattresses: Hybrid mattresses combine memory foam and innerspring coils to offer a balanced feel. They provide the comfort of foam with the support of coils. Research from the International Sleep Products Association in 2022 indicates that hybrids satisfy a variety of sleep positions. Brands such as Purple focus on innovative designs, enhancing airflow and responsiveness.

  4. Latex Mattresses: Latex mattresses feature natural or synthetic latex, known for its durability and bounce. They are resistant to allergens and offer good support. The Global Organic Textile Standard (GOTS) states that natural latex reduces the risk of overheating, making it suitable for hot sleepers. Companies like Avocado are recognized for their eco-friendly latex options.

  5. Adjustable Air Mattresses: Adjustable air mattresses allow users to customize firmness levels with air chambers. This flexibility accommodates couples with different preferences. A 2022 report from Sleep Like The Dead suggests these mattresses cater well to back pain sufferers due to adjustable lumbar support. Brands like Sleep Number excel in this market with smart features.

  6. Eco-Friendly Mattresses: Eco-friendly mattresses utilize sustainable materials such as organic cotton or plant-based foams. These mattresses appeal to environmentally conscious consumers. A 2023 study by Green America highlights the importance of non-toxic materials in reducing exposure to harmful chemicals. Brands like Naturepedic are at the forefront of this movement, ensuring safety and comfort.

What Should Be Considered When Choosing Your Ideal Mattress?

When choosing your ideal mattress, consider the following factors: comfort, support, material, firmness level, size, durability, and price.

  1. Comfort
  2. Support
  3. Material
  4. Firmness level
  5. Size
  6. Durability
  7. Price

Understanding these factors leads to an informed mattress selection tailored to personal preferences.

  1. Comfort: Comfort refers to how pleasant the mattress feels during sleep. Individual preferences differ, as some people prefer a soft surface, while others seek a firmer feel. Studies suggest that comfort significantly influences sleep quality. A 2015 study published in the Journal of Chiropractic Medicine indicated that individuals who rated their bed’s comfort higher reported fewer sleep disturbances.

  2. Support: Support involves how well a mattress aligns the spine and cradles the body. Good support helps maintain a natural spinal curve and alleviates pressure points. The American Academy of Sleep Medicine states that proper support can reduce back pain and promote better sleep quality. The ideal support varies based on body weight and sleeping position.

  3. Material: The material determines the mattress’s feel, breathability, and durability. Common materials include memory foam, latex, and innerspring. Each type offers different benefits. For example, memory foam conforms to the body’s shape and provides good pressure relief, while latex offers responsiveness and a cooler sleep experience.

  4. Firmness Level: Firmness level indicates the mattress’s resistance to compression. Ratings typically range from soft to firm. Research shows that medium-firm mattresses are often the most preferred, as they offer a balance of comfort and support. A study by the National Sleep Foundation found that medium-firm mattresses positively impacted sleep quality for many users.

  5. Size: Size matters in mattress selection, impacting the space available for movement and comfort. Common sizes include twin, full, queen, and king. Couples may prefer a larger size to minimize disturbances during the night. A larger mattress can also accommodate those who move around frequently while sleeping.

  6. Durability: Durability refers to how long a mattress maintains its supportive and comfortable properties. Quality construction and materials directly influence a mattress’s lifespan. According to Consumer Reports, the average mattress lasts about 7-10 years, but higher-quality options can exceed this duration.

  7. Price: Price is a critical factor. Mattress prices range significantly based on brand, materials, and features. Budget constraints should be considered, but investing in a quality mattress is often recommended for long-term health and comfort. The Sleep Foundation notes that a good mattress can lead to better overall health and well-being, making it a valuable investment.
